Thorpe Acre Junior School continues to perform well, maintaining its status as a good school. Leaders demonstrate high aspirations for all pupils, emphasizing a culture of respect, safety, and strong relationships. Pupils engage enthusiastically with their learning, showcasing pride in their achievements and benefiting from a broad, balanced curriculum designed with their needs in mind, including those with special educational needs. Recent efforts to enhance writing skills are yielding positive results, creating a more purposeful learning environment.

Progress Scores

A progress score is a way to measure how well a student progressed in comparison to other students of a similar starting ability. A score of zero means would mean that a student made the same progress as others that had a similar starting a ability. A positive score would mean that the student made more progress than other students of similar starting ability. The scores below are for the whole school so is the average progress score across all students.
